Research Vessel Engineer — University of Wisconsin–Milwaukee
The Research Vessel Engineer operates and maintains the mechanical systems necessary to operate the School of Freshwater Sciences research vessel in support of Freshwater's educational and research activities both at sea and in port, assists the Captain with vessel operation, assists faculty, staff, and students in executing safe and efficient field operations, and provides general facility support. The School of Freshwater Sciences (SFS) at UWM is the only school in the nation dedicated solely to the study of freshwater issues. Its interdisciplinary research and education programs link science with action and are integrated across five major areas: freshwater system dynamics; human and ecosystem health; freshwater technology; freshwater economics, policy, and management; and climate and atmospheric sciences.
